1. The Undertaker Vs. Shawn Michaels

Don’t rule out the architects of the greatest non-title match in WrestleMania history doing it all again 10 years later.

When Shawn Michaels announced the end of his eight-year retirement to team up with Triple H and face The Brothers of Destruction at Crown Jewel in November, people were already booking his next match. While fans would love to see HBK battle some new blood such as Daniel Bryan or AJ Styles, WWE keep going back to the well with his fiercest rival.

The ending of the Crown Jewel match left room for another chapter of this legendary story, with Triple H pinning Kane denying Michaels true retribution for the ending of his career.

There are no other feasible candidates to face ‘The Phenom’, with the most plausible alternative being no Undertaker at all, for the first time at WrestleMania in 18 years. ‘The Deadman’ has recently stepped away from the WWE brand to apparently go into business for himself, so this rematch now seems unlikely, for this year at least.

However, bookmakers still make Undertaker vs. Michaels the third favourite match to headline MetLife Stadium, if multiple versions of the Becky, Charlotte, Ronda scenario are counted as one, so maybe WWE has a big surprise planned for the road to WrestleMania?
